Contrast

#fdf9ec as textRatioAAAA largeAAAFix
Aaon white
1.05:1failfailfail
  • AA: use #8f710f as the text (4.63:1)
  • AAA: use #6a540b as the text (7.28:1)
  • AA: or shift the background to #737373 (4.5:1)
  • AAA: or shift the background to #545454 (7.19:1)
Aaon black
19.94:1passpasspassPasses AAA — no fix needed.

Fixes keep hue and saturation and move lightness only, so the suggestion stays on-brand. Ratios are symmetric: the same numbers apply with #fdf9ec as the background.
